A DAY IN LIFE AS A SR. CONSTRUCTION MANAGER
Duties And Responsibilities
The functions listed below are those that represent the majority of the time spent working in this class. Management may assign additional functions related to the type of work of the class as necessary. These essential functions require presence in the workplace on a regular basis and regular attendance must be maintained.
Essential Functions
Exercises direct supervision over construction management staff, consultants, contractors and/or support staff, as assigned throughout the construction phase.
Directs the work of construction projects within the Engineering Division to include the construction of streets, storm drains, parks, traffic control systems, water and wastewater facilities and other Capital Improvement Program (CIP) projects.
Provides direction and management for multiple large and complex Public Work, Construction and CIP Projects. Ensures on-schedule completion within budget in accordance with contract documents and local, State and Federal laws and regulations.

Applies judgment on construction related problems and trouble shoots to expedite execution, completion, and closeout of projects.
Monitors the performance of materials testing technicians, inspectors, and other professionals contracted by the city to ensure work efforts are conducted in accordance with standard specifications.
Monitors the progress of work by contractors for the purpose of reviewing and approving monthly progress payment applications.
Conducts progress meetings with project stakeholders including end-user departments, consultants, contractors, subcontractors, and external entities/agencies to provide direction & policy interpretation for assigned projects.
Contract administration, including negotiating and issuing change orders; reviewing work to ensure compliance with plans, specifications, milestones, and budgets.
Reviews and responds to submittals, RFIs, and other project correspondence.
Prepares and administers non-compliance notices for completed work not conforming to contract requirements.
Provides information to the public; investigate complaints and recommend corrective action as necessary to resolve complaints. Interpret and explain pertinent public works construction and department policies and procedures.
Understands and enforces compliance with engineering plans, specifications, bid documents, and contract provisions.
Field responsibilities include performing site visits, quality assurance inspection of the contractor's work to confirm compliance with contract requirements, project close-out punch list inspections.
Plan, prioritize, assign, supervise, and review the work of staff involved in public works construction management.
Provides guidance and training to less experienced staff; and participates in employee evaluations.
Assists Project Managers in the selection of bid procedures and contractors.
Assigns tasks and supervises/reviews work of Construction Manager(s).
Interacts with outside agencies to coordinate construction efforts between city projects and those of other entities.
